Recent Price Action
Advertisement
Curaleaf Holdings Inc. (CURA.TO) has seen its stock price close at C$13.29, reflecting a 2.42% decrease in the last trading session. Over the past week, the stock has declined by 3.13%, and it is down 3.70% for the month. Year-to-date, Curaleaf has managed to achieve a notable gain of 23.74%, indicating some resilience despite recent challenges.
Company News
Recent developments have placed Curaleaf under the spotlight. The ongoing competitive tension with Aurora Cannabis has escalated, with both companies engaging in a hostile bid situation. On September 2, Curaleaf responded to Aurora's circular, reaffirming its position that its offer is the best path for shareholder value creation. This strategic maneuvering has contributed to the stock's recent volatility as investors assess the implications of these corporate actions.
Technical Picture
From a technical standpoint, Curaleaf's stock is currently trading close to its 50-day moving average of C$13.32, indicating a slight underperformance of 0.3%. The 200-day moving average, however, stands at C$12.07, suggesting a healthier long-term trend with a 10.1% gain compared to the current price. The stock's 52-week range has been between C$7.77 and C$20.93, with the current price at approximately 42% of this range. The stock has a beta of 1.64, indicating higher volatility than the broader market.
